Output 170059c05dc97b31843e9ae63d82a9229b7300e789c222667b697ad92d426cf7:0
- value
- 621019056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cda34d54dcfac61a7885738811db8183aa0eae00 OP_EQUAL
- address
- 3LSL5J8XZqyeUXgVpFd6T9HnpAuJNe2qH1
- transaction
- 170059c05dc97b31843e9ae63d82a9229b7300e789c222667b697ad92d426cf7
- spent
- true